Publication number: 20240128091Abstract: A method includes providing, within an etch chamber, a base structure including a target layer disposed on a substrate, and an etch mask disposed on the target layer, dry etching, within the etch chamber, the target layer using thionyl chloride to obtain a processed base structure, and after forming the plurality of features. The processed base structure includes a plurality of features and a plurality of openings defined by the etch mask. The method further includes removing the processed base structure from the etch chamber. In some embodiments, the target layer includes carbon. In some embodiments, the dry etching is performed at a sub-zero degree temperature.Type: ApplicationFiled: July 12, 2023Publication date: April 18, 2024Inventors: Zhonghua Yao, Qian Fu, Mark J. Publication number: 20240074665Abstract: An electronic device includes a housing defining an internal volume, a front opening, and a rear opening. The electronic device can include a display component disposed at the front opening and a rear cover disposed at the rear opening. A logic board can be disposed in the internal volume. The device can also include a thin film thermopile including a cold junction bonded to the logic board and a hot junction bonded to the rear cover.Type: ApplicationFiled: December 28, 2022Publication date: March 7, 2024Inventors: Daniel J. Publication number: 20170027473Abstract: A physiology sensing device and an intelligent textile are provided. The physiology sensing device includes a fabric substrate and a conductive coating layer. The conductive coating layer is embedded from a side of the fabric substrate and leveled with the fabric body, and a thickness of the conductive coating layer is not larger than a thickness of the fabric substrate. The conductive coating layer includes a hydrophobic adhesive and a plurality of conductive particles distributing therein. The physiology sensing device receives variation of a signal of body potential on skin surface. Then a long range signal receiver receives the signal, the signal is shown on a monitory system so as to perform long distance monitoring.Type: ApplicationFiled: April 12, 2016Publication date: February 2, 2017Inventors: Hsin-Kai LAI, Wei-Che HUNG, Yu-June WU, Jeffrey-Fu HSU

Patent number: 8477847Abstract: A video encoder includes a mode decision module that determines a final macroblock cost for each macroblock of the plurality of macroblocks based on costs associated with a plurality of motion vectors. An intra pulse code modulation (IPCM) module, when enabled, selects an IPCM mode when the final macroblock cost compares unfavorably to an IPCM threshold. A reconstruction module generates residual pixel values for each macroblock of the plurality of macroblocks and a transform and quantization module, transforms and quantizes the residual pixel values when the IPCM mode is not selected.Type: GrantFiled: December 17, 2007Date of Patent: July 2, 2013Assignee: ViXS Systems, Inc.Inventors: Xu Gang (Wilf) Zhao, Xinghai Li, Jeffrey (Fu) Jin

Patent number: 8355447Abstract: A run-level coding module can be used in a video encoder that generates a processed video signal from a video input signal. The run-level coding module includes a run-level coder that generates a first plurality of run-level pairs from a first stream of quantized data. A first ring buffer buffers a first number of the first plurality of run-level pairs. The processed video signal is generated based on the buffered first number of run-level pairs.Type: GrantFiled: December 19, 2007Date of Patent: January 15, 2013Assignee: ViXS Systems, Inc.Inventors: Xu Gang (Wilf) Zhao, Xinghai Li, Zhong Yan (Jason) Wang, Ruijing (Ray) Dong, Jeffrey (Fu) Jin

Patent number: 7422442Abstract: An LGA socket (1) includes an insulative housing (2) and a plurality of conductive contacts (3) received in the housing. The housing defines a recessed area (25) surrounded by a number of sidewalls (21). The contacts are received in the recessed area. Each of the sidewall defines a plurality of slots (27) and a plurality of corresponding shielding terminals (4) fastened in the slots. Each shielding terminal includes a fastening portion (41), a linking portion (43) extending from the fastening portion, a first contacting arm (421) extending from one end of the linking portion, and a second contacting arm (422) extending form the other end of the linking portion. The first and second contacting arms dispose out of the sots for elastically connecting with external components.Type: GrantFiled: June 26, 2007Date of Patent: September 9, 2008Assignee: Hon Hai Precision Ind. Patent number: 5494808Abstract: A new fermentation process for the culture of Neisseria meningitidis incorporates a wholly synthetic medium and event based processing decisions. This process is capable of generating cells at production scale for the extraction and purification of outer membrane protein complex (OMPC) vesicles which are useful as a protein carrier for PedvaxHIB.RTM. and pneumococcal conjugate vaccines.Type: GrantFiled: October 31, 1994Date of Patent: February 27, 1996Assignee: Merck & Co., Inc.Inventor: Jeffrey Fu
